The oxygen sensor is positioned within the exhaust manifold. It’s a small, cylindrical gadget with a wire working by means of it. The wire is coated with a particular materials that reacts to oxygen. When the engine is working, the oxygen within the exhaust gasoline reacts with the fabric on the wire, which generates a voltage. The voltage is then despatched to the engine’s pc, which makes use of it to regulate the air/gas combination.
Over time, the oxygen sensor can turn out to be soiled and clogged with carbon deposits. This could stop the sensor from precisely measuring the oxygen within the exhaust gasoline, which may result in a variety of issues, together with: Elevated gas consumption, decreased engine efficiency, and elevated emissions. Testing the Oxygen Sensor Performance
1. Visible Inspection: Look at the oxygen sensor for any seen harm or corrosion on the physique or wiring. Verify for free or disconnected connectors.
2. Verify Resistance: Use a multimeter to measure the resistance between the sensor’s sign wire (often black) and floor wire (often grey). A great oxygen sensor ought to have a resistance between 0.5 and 10 ohms.
3. Measure Voltage Output: Begin the engine and run it at idle. Join a multimeter to the sensor’s sign wire and floor wire. The voltage ought to fluctuate between 0.1 and 0.9 volts at working temperature.
4. Wealthy/Lean Check: Use a scan instrument or multimeter to watch the sensor’s voltage output whereas working the engine. Spray a small quantity of propane or carburetor cleaner close to the exhaust manifold. A great sensor will present a lean response (voltage enhance) to a lean situation and a wealthy response (voltage lower) to a wealthy situation.
5. Catalyst Monitor Check: If the automobile has a catalyst monitor, run the engine at 2500 RPM for at the least 5 minutes. Monitor the sensor’s voltage output. The voltage ought to rise and fall (referred to as “biking”) usually.
6. Heater Circuit Check: Begin the engine and use a voltmeter to measure the voltage between the sensor’s heater terminals (usually crimson and white). The voltage needs to be round 12 volts.
7. Floor Circuit Check: Disconnect the oxygen sensor and use a check mild to test for voltage between the sensor’s floor wire and the engine block. The check mild ought to illuminate if the bottom circuit is full.
8. Response Time Check: Begin the engine and join a scan instrument or multimeter to the sensor’s sign wire and floor wire. File the voltage output. Rapidly spray a small quantity of propane or carburetor cleaner close to the exhaust manifold. The voltage ought to reply rapidly to the change in gas combination.
9. Detailed Voltage Output Chart:
| Oxygen Sensor Voltage | Gasoline Combination | 
|---|---|
| 0.1 – 0.2 volts | Very lean | 
| 0.2 – 0.4 volts | Lean | 
| 0.4 – 0.6 volts | Stoichiometric (supreme) | 
| 0.6 – 0.8 volts | Wealthy | 
| 0.8 – 0.9 volts | Very wealthy |
